User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; en-US; rv:1.7.10) Gecko/20050716 Firefox/1.0.6 Build Identifier: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; en-US; rv:1.7.10) Gecko/20050716 Firefox/1.0.6 If you increase the font size sufficiently the top blue & red graphic bar at the top of the page (urled above) is reproduced twice; Erroneously further down the page. Occurs in Mozilla 1.7.11, too.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Increase font size 2x (Dell 700m) or more 2. Scroll down page and the red/blue graphic appears across the page. 3. Actual Results: Second graphic band appears
